看我在XP家庭版中安装IIS搭建自己的网络小窝
相信许多的网民朋友们都想在网络有一个属于自己的窝吧,怎么办呢?如今这世道可不能指望什么免费的网页空间能让你安安稳稳的建立小窝,不是打着免费的幌子叫你帮定手机注册就是弹出成堆成堆的广告,偶有几个可以用的,不过如昙花一现般一觉醒来便烟消云散了。怎么办呢?在自己的电脑上搭吧,用专门的建站软件来搭?一来这需要你安装第三方的软件会给自己本不富裕的系统资源增加负担,设置管理起来也比较繁琐。二来介绍这方面的文章已经很多了,也不是本文关注的问题。
既然微软那么好心在系统中就制作了IIS这么一个建站用的好东东那么为什么不用呢?
可大家都知道在Windows XP Home(Windows XP 家庭版)版本中是没有IIS这个组件的,但是绝大部分的电脑都只附带家庭版的XP,难道除了花钱升级成专业版的XP以外就没办法了吗?回答当然是否定的,今天我就告诉大家怎样让IIS乖乖的住进家庭版的XP里。
首先你需要一张Windows 2000 Professional的安装光盘,这个应该很容易找到吧。
然后便要在你的XP上动土了,不要认为这很麻烦,其实很简单。跟我一步一步做吧!
将准备好的Windows 2000 Professional安装光盘放入光驱
用记事本打开x:\windows\inf\sysoc.inf(x为XP系统所在分区,例如“c:”)
然后搜索“[Components]”(不含引号,下同)在下面几行字符中找到
“iis=iis.dll,OcEntry,iis.inf,hide,7”
这一行,将这一行替换为
“iis=iis2.dll,OcEntry,iis2.inf,,7”,
保存退出
接下来点击“开始”菜单选择“运行”(也可以按下“Win+R”快捷键)输入“CMD”确定,打开命令行模式,在命令行模式中输入
“Expand g:\i386\iis.dl_ c:\windows\system32\setup\iis2.dll”回车
“Expand g:\i386\iis.in_ c:\windows\inf\iis2.inf”回车
(这里“g:\i386...”中的“g”为你的光驱盘符)
完事后打开“控制面板”点击“添加删除程序”在点击“添加删除Windows组件”这是你就可以在这里看见IIS的安装选项了钩上以后点击确定IIS便会从Windows 2000的安装盘中安装到你的XP系统里了,等待安装结束以后你便可以使用IIS来建立你的小窝了,怎么样?听轻松的吧!
剩下的事情就需要你查找IIS建站的相关帮助了,这方面的资料很多,在网上可以很容易搜索到的。
通过这样安装的IIS可以完全正常使用HTTP服务和FTP服务,完全满足我们建立个人小站的需要
最后要有2个问题需要说明一下
1、在安装过程中,如果提示你插入Window CD或提示找不到“exch_adsiisex.dll”这个文件,是因为你按照默认的选项安装了IIS。要解决这个问题,只要在安装IIS的时候先点击"详细信息",然后勾掉SMTP前的小钩,也就是不安装SMTP服务,这样就不会出现这个问题了。
2、另外必须使用Windows 2000 Professional中的文件来安装IIS,如果使用Windows XP Professional的话将会出现无法正常安装的现象。